diff options
author | Lars Wendler <polynomial-c@gentoo.org> | 2016-12-12 22:04:21 +0100 |
---|---|---|
committer | Lars Wendler <polynomial-c@gentoo.org> | 2016-12-12 22:04:21 +0100 |
commit | d47da5b055f1de629a4761eeae94ce2aceff5d56 (patch) | |
tree | 56db2b9b82544651f475bb562e897541b037264a /sys-apps/man-db | |
parent | sys-apps/man-db: Removed old. (diff) | |
download | gentoo-d47da5b055f1de629a4761eeae94ce2aceff5d56.tar.gz gentoo-d47da5b055f1de629a4761eeae94ce2aceff5d56.tar.bz2 gentoo-d47da5b055f1de629a4761eeae94ce2aceff5d56.zip |
sys-apps/man-db: Adjust cache dir permissions as preferred by upstream.
Package-Manager: Portage-2.3.3, Repoman-2.3.1
Diffstat (limited to 'sys-apps/man-db')
-rw-r--r-- | sys-apps/man-db/man-db-2.7.6.1.ebuild |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/sys-apps/man-db/man-db-2.7.6.1.ebuild b/sys-apps/man-db/man-db-2.7.6.1.ebuild index c7a5f11d7e74..8af552f98350 100644 --- a/sys-apps/man-db/man-db-2.7.6.1.ebuild +++ b/sys-apps/man-db/man-db-2.7.6.1.ebuild @@ -70,8 +70,8 @@ src_install() { newexe "${FILESDIR}"/man-db.cron man-db #289884 keepdir /var/cache/man - fowners man:0 /var/cache/man - fperms 2755 /var/cache/man + fowners man:man /var/cache/man + fperms 0755 /var/cache/man } pkg_preinst() { @@ -82,8 +82,8 @@ pkg_preinst() { if [[ ! -g ${EROOT}var/cache/man ]] ; then einfo "Resetting permissions on ${EROOT}var/cache/man" #447944 mkdir -p "${EROOT}var/cache/man" - chown -R man:0 "${EROOT}"var/cache/man - find "${EROOT}"var/cache/man -type d '!' -perm /g=s -exec chmod 2755 {} + + chown -R man:man "${EROOT}"var/cache/man + find "${EROOT}"var/cache/man -type d -exec chmod 0755 {} + fi } |